Transaction 21036690ad862ce92f24583bdf36ace018ba248d2ac00f04247e78e07e9cb281
1 Input
1 Output
-
21036690ad862ce92f24583bdf36ace018ba248d2ac00f04247e78e07e9cb281:0
- value
- 317000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97b363a4015f97cce601cf13f154de1912fe60b8 OP_EQUAL
- address
- 3FX8rh5JyQjpLSXn3pwjtQeCQZQm3ba1vh